In our studies on the physiological importance of fats to the animal organism (l), we became convinced that progress could be made only when individual fatty acids were used. Even the most simple natural fat is a complex entity. In addition to glycerides of fatty acids, we have the substances collectively called the nonsaponifiable matter. From the present standpoint these may be looked upon as impurities associated with the glycerides of the fatty acids. The glycerides themselves are complex; witness the multiplicity of differing fatty acids, saturated and unsaturated, present, and the possible isomeric arrangements in the glycerol molecule. Only when synthetic fats composed of single fatty acids are used in experimental diets will it be possible to accumulate a body of data which will lead to a better understanding of the Ale played by fats in the animal organism. The present communication is concerned with the role of single saturated fatty acids when vitamin B and, in fact, all the known vitamins are adequately supplied. When single fatty acids were used as the sole source of energy in the diet, certain phenomena akin to those obtained in studies on fat-free diets were manifested (2, 3). There were discovered similarities, but also some vital differences.
